Dodge's blatant pandering to women buyers with the La Femme did not pan out, and its ludicrous amount of accessories only lead to unsuccessful excess.
Set to cross the block at the Mecum Glendale auction this coming March, this 1972 Dodge Demon is a muscle car that pairs modern Mopar power with classic '70s cool. Parent Corporation Stellantis ...